Network [1..1] VLAN Voice Mode
Set the VLAN voice mode.
Requires user role:
ADMIN
Value space:
<Tagged/Untagged>
Tagged: The voice packets in the VLAN network are tagged with VlanId and Priority.
Untagged: The voice packets in the VLAN network are untagged.
Example:
Network 1 VLAN Voice Mode: Untagged
Network [1..1] VLAN Voice VlanId
Set the VLAN voice ID.
Requires user role:
ADMIN
Value space:
<0..4096>
Range: Select a value from 0 to 4096.
Example:
Network 1 VLAN Voice VlanId: 0
Network [1..1] VLAN Voice Priority
Set the VLAN voice priority.
Requires user role:
ADMIN
Value space:
<0..7>
Range: Select a value from 0 to 7.
Example:
Network 1 VLAN Voice Priority: 0
Network [1] VLAN data Mode
Set the VLAN data mode.
Requires user role:
ADMIN
Value space:
<Tagged/Untagged>
Tagged: The data packets in the VLAN network are tagged with Data VlanId and Data Priority.
Untagged: The data packets in the VLAN network are untagged.
Example:
Network 1 VLAN Data Mode: Untagged
Network [1] VLAN data VlanId
Set the VLAN data ID.
Requires user role:
ADMIN
Value space:
<0..4096>
Range: Select a value from 0 to 4096.
Example:
Network 1 VLAN Data VlanId: 0

Network [1] VLAN data Priority
Set the VLAN data priority.
Requires user role:
ADMIN
Value space:
<0..7>
Range: Select a value from 0 to 7.
Example:
Network 1 VLAN Data Priority: 0
Network [1..1] IPv6 Address
Enter the static IPv6 network address for the system. Only applicable if the Network IPv6 Assignment
is set to Static.
Requires user role:
ADMIN
Value space:
<S: 0, 64>
Format: The IPv6 address of host name.
Example:
Network 1 IPv6 Address: "ffff:ffff:ffff:ffff:ffff:ffff:ffff:ffff"
Network [1..1] IPv6 Gateway
Define the IPv6 network gateway address. Only applicable if the Network IPv6 Assignment is set to
Static.
Requires user role:
ADMIN
Value space:
<S: 0, 64>
Format: The IPv6 address of host name.
Example:
Network 1 IPv6 Gateway: "ffff:ffff:ffff:ffff:ffff:ffff:ffff:ffff"
Network [1..1] IPv6 Assignment
Define whether to use Autoconf or Static IPv6 assignment.
Requires user role:
ADMIN
Value space:
<Static/Autoconf>
Static: Set the network assignment to Static and configure the static IPv6 settings (IP Address and
Gateway).
Autoconf: Enable IPv6 stateless autoconfiguration of the IPv6 network interface. See RFC4862 for
a detailed description.
Example:
Network 1 IPv6 Assignment: Autoconf
